zap gcc2 patches
OK naddy@
This commit is contained in:
parent
25a3f79e15
commit
bf93d0fd4a
@ -1,8 +1,8 @@
|
||||
# $OpenBSD: Makefile,v 1.39 2013/07/04 15:12:34 gsoares Exp $
|
||||
# $OpenBSD: Makefile,v 1.40 2013/08/07 19:13:11 gsoares Exp $
|
||||
|
||||
COMMENT= open source client for Windows Terminal Server
|
||||
DISTNAME= rdesktop-1.7.1
|
||||
REVISION= 1
|
||||
REVISION= 2
|
||||
CATEGORIES= x11 net
|
||||
M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=rdesktop/}
|
||||
|
||||
|
@ -1,39 +0,0 @@
|
||||
$OpenBSD: patch-rdesktop_c,v 1.2 2012/03/14 18:36:04 gsoares Exp $
|
||||
|
||||
fix build with gcc-2.95
|
||||
|
||||
--- rdesktop.c.orig Fri Nov 25 08:03:03 2011
|
||||
+++ rdesktop.c Tue Mar 13 13:53:08 2012
|
||||
@@ -473,6 +473,7 @@ main(int argc, char *argv[])
|
||||
char *locale = NULL;
|
||||
int username_option = 0;
|
||||
RD_BOOL geometry_option = False;
|
||||
+ struct sigaction act;
|
||||
#ifdef WITH_RDPSND
|
||||
char *rdpsnd_optarg = NULL;
|
||||
#endif
|
||||
@@ -488,7 +489,6 @@ main(int argc, char *argv[])
|
||||
#endif
|
||||
|
||||
/* Ignore SIGPIPE, since we are using popen() */
|
||||
- struct sigaction act;
|
||||
memset(&act, 0, sizeof(act));
|
||||
act.sa_handler = SIG_IGN;
|
||||
sigemptyset(&act.sa_mask);
|
||||
@@ -901,6 +901,7 @@ main(int argc, char *argv[])
|
||||
|
||||
if (!username_option)
|
||||
{
|
||||
+ int pwlen;
|
||||
pw = getpwuid(getuid());
|
||||
if ((pw == NULL) || (pw->pw_name == NULL))
|
||||
{
|
||||
@@ -908,7 +909,7 @@ main(int argc, char *argv[])
|
||||
return EX_OSERR;
|
||||
}
|
||||
/* +1 for trailing \0 */
|
||||
- int pwlen = strlen(pw->pw_name) + 1;
|
||||
+ pwlen = strlen(pw->pw_name) + 1;
|
||||
g_username = (char *) xmalloc(pwlen);
|
||||
STRNCPY(g_username, pw->pw_name, pwlen);
|
||||
}
|
@ -1,22 +0,0 @@
|
||||
$OpenBSD: patch-xclip_c,v 1.1 2011/06/23 15:17:13 sebastia Exp $
|
||||
|
||||
fix build with gcc-2.95
|
||||
|
||||
--- xclip.c.orig Wed Jun 22 16:17:57 2011
|
||||
+++ xclip.c Wed Jun 22 16:18:21 2011
|
||||
@@ -158,6 +158,7 @@ utf16_lf2crlf(uint8 * data, uint32 * size)
|
||||
uint8 *result;
|
||||
uint16 *inptr, *outptr;
|
||||
RD_BOOL swap_endianess;
|
||||
+ uint16 uvalue_previous = 0; /* Kept so we'll avoid translating CR-LF to CR-CR-LF */
|
||||
|
||||
/* Worst case: Every char is LF */
|
||||
result = xmalloc((*size * 2) + 2);
|
||||
@@ -170,7 +171,6 @@ utf16_lf2crlf(uint8 * data, uint32 * size)
|
||||
/* Check for a reversed BOM */
|
||||
swap_endianess = (*inptr == 0xfffe);
|
||||
|
||||
- uint16 uvalue_previous = 0; /* Kept so we'll avoid translating CR-LF to CR-CR-LF */
|
||||
while ((uint8 *) inptr < data + *size)
|
||||
{
|
||||
uint16 uvalue = *inptr;
|
Loading…
x
Reference in New Issue
Block a user